bernstein_tasks

List tasks from the Bernstein server. Args: status: Optional filter - open, claimed, in_progress, done, failed, blocked, or cancelled. Returns: JSON array of task objects.

Low Risk

This tool retrieves and queries task data without modifying, creating, deleting, or executing any operations. It is purely informational, matching the Read category profile of 'retrieves or queries data; no side effects (search, list, get, fetch)'. The blast radius of misuse is minimal—an agent could only view task information it may not be authorized to see, but cannot modify or harm systems.

From the tool's definition Tool name 'bernstein_tasks' and description 'List tasks from the Bernstein server' indicate a retrieval operation with no side effects. The function accepts only a filter parameter (status) for querying and returns a JSON array of task objects.

Can I rate-limit bernstein_tasks? +

Yes. Add a rate_limit block to the bernstein_tasks r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.

How do I block bernstein_tasks completely? +

Set action: deny in the PolicyLayer policy for bernstein_tasks.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
